Candy Crush Solitaire: A Sweet Twist on a Classic Card Game
King, the creators of Candy Crush Saga, are entering the solitaire arena with their new game, Candy Crush Solitaire, launching February 6th on iOS and Android. This isn't just any solitaire game; it's a blend of classic tripeaks solitaire gameplay infused with the familiar boosters, blockers, and progression system that Candy Crush fans adore.
The game's release follows the recent success of Balatro, a roguelike poker game, suggesting King is aiming to capitalize on the popularity of innovative card game formats. While some developers have released inferior imitations, King's approach is a strategic integration of their established franchise into a new genre.
Pre-registration is now open on both iOS and Android platforms. Early birds will receive exclusive in-game rewards, including a unique card back, 5,000 coins, four undos, two fish cards, and three color bomb cards.
A Calculated Risk?
King's reliance on the Candy Crush brand is well-documented. Unlike some competitors, they haven't heavily invested in experimental titles. Candy Crush Solitaire could be interpreted as a calculated move to explore new avenues for engaging their existing audience while tapping into the established popularity of solitaire. The game's familiar mechanics and established player base could prove a safer bet than venturing into completely uncharted territory. The success of Balatro likely played a role in this decision, demonstrating the market's appetite for innovative card game experiences. Solitaire's classic appeal offers a broader audience reach compared to a more niche title like Balatro.
